PCB stands for Physics-Chemistry and Biology; Science combination that allows a student to acquire knowledge that is necessary to perfome careers in a large number of fields. It is a master combination in health carrier. For eligibility and admission requirement refer to TCU Guidebook.

In This article we explore programmes/courses that a graduate of PCB can take in any field.

PCB Jobs and Opportunities After Graduation

Graduates with a background in PCB have a wide range of career opportunities available to them in Tanzania. Some of the jobs and opportunities include:

1. Research Scientist: Conducting scientific research and experiments in fields such as physics, chemistry, and mathematics.

2. Engineer: Designing and developing systems, structures, and devices in various engineering disciplines.

3. Medical Doctor: Providing medical care and treatment to patients in h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are settings.

4. Pharmacist: Dispensing medications and providing pharmaceutical care to patients.

5. Computer Programmer: Writing, testing, and debugging computer programs and software applications.

6. Environmental Scientist: Studying the impact of human activities on the environment and developing solutions to environmental problems.

7. Actuary: Analyzing financial risks and uncertainties for insurance companies, banks, and other financial institutions.

8. Geologist: Studying Earth’s materials, structures, and processes to locate and extract mineral resources.

9. Civil Engineer: Designing and overseeing the construction of infrastructure projects such as buildings, bridges, and roads.

10. Industrial Chemist: Developing and testing chemical products and processes in manufacturing industries.

11. Biochemist: Studying the chemical processes and substances in living organisms, with applications in healthcare, agriculture, and biotechnology.

12. Materials Engineer: Designing and testing materials for specific applications in industries such as aerospace, automotive, and electronics.

13. Agricultural Engineer: Designing and improving agricultural machinery, equipment, and systems to increase productivity and efficiency.

14. Telecommunications Engineer: Designing, installing, and maintaining telecommunications systems and networks.

15. Renewable Energy Specialist: Developing and implementing sustainable energy solutions using renewable energy sources.
